As an example of referral fees in August of 2015 the Department of Justice announced two Southwest Missouri health care providers agreed to pay the United States $5.5 million to settle allegations that they violated the False Claims Act by engaging in improper financial relationships with referring physicians.

The settlement resolved allegations that the defendants submitted false claims to the Medicare program for services rendered to patients referred by physicians who received bonuses based on a formula that improperly took into account the value of the physicians' referrals of patients to the clinic. Federal law restricts the financial relationships that hospitals and clinics may have with doctors who refer patients to them.

In this instance the whistleblower will receive $825,000 for their information.
